Umbrella-shaped antenna structure parameter optimization design method based on optimal consistence parameter

The invention discloses an umbrella-shaped antenna structure parameter optimization design method based on optimal consistence parameters. The method specifically comprises the following steps: inputting structure parameters and electronic parameters of an umbrella-shaped antenna; calculating segment numbers of antenna ribs; calculating coordinates of points on the ribs; calculating coordinates of points of adjacent ribs; generating all node coordinates of the umbrella-shaped antenna; calculating a node optical path difference direct-ratio vector; calculating a node consistence geometric matrix; calculating a weighting matrix; calculating an optimal consistence parameter column vector; outputting axial precision of the umbrella-shaped antenna; judging whether the axial precision meets requirements or not; outputting the structure parameters of the umbrella-shaped antenna; and updating the structure parameters of the umbrella-shaped antenna. By adopting the umbrella-shaped antenna structure parameter optimization design method, the characteristic that the umbrella-shaped antenna is assembled through surface-piece splicing manner is taken into account, the axial precision of the umbrella-shaped antenna is analyzed based on the concept of an optima consistence paraboloid, the electronic parameters of the antenna are introduced into calculation of the axial precision, and thus the axial precision of the umbrella-shaped antenna is obtained through the optimal consistence parameters; and by adopting the method, mechanical structure design and mechanical-electric integration optimization design of umbrella-shaped antennas can be instructed.

[1]  Qiu Jing-Hui,et al.  Research on quasi-optics and feed antenna for Millimeter wave imaging system , 2010, Proceedings of the 9th International Symposium on Antennas, Propagation and EM Theory.